Variant SH3 domain
PF07653
Definition
SH3 (Src homology 3) domains are often indicative of a protein involved in signal transduction related to cytoskeletal organisation. First described in the Src cytoplasmic tyrosine kinase [swissprot:P12931]. The structure is a partly opened beta barrel.
